Spirituality can be a powerful source of meaning, connection, and grounding; but it can also become complicated, especially if you’re questioning long-held beliefs, navigating religious trauma, or feeling disconnected from the traditions you grew up with. Many people find themselves in a season of deconstruction, unsure of what still fits, what no longer aligns, and what they want to carry forward. In our work together, I offer a compassionate, non-judgmental space to explore your spiritual story at your own pace. Whether you’re re-evaluating beliefs, healing from harmful teachings, or seeking a spirituality that feels authentic and life-giving, we gently sort through what’s yours and what was placed on you. Drawing from narrative therapy, parts work, and values-based approaches, I support you in clarifying what truly matters to you, understanding how your spiritual experiences have shaped you, and reconnecting to a sense of meaning that aligns with your values and identity today. You don’t need to have everything figured out. Together, we can explore the questions, honour your lived experience, and help you build a grounded, personally meaningful path forward.

Spirituality therapists in New Hamburg, Ontario, Canada Statistics

Spirituality therapists in New Hamburg, Ontario, Canada average 11 years of experience and charge around $183 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(71%), Emotionally Focused Therapy (EFT) (59%), and Solution-Focused Brief Therapy (SFBT) (53%).
